Abs Diet Recipes That Are Fun and Easy
By. B Shelton

Abs diet recipes have something of a reputation for being dull. Ever gone to a restaurant and ordered the "diet plate", only to have your waiter bring you a plate of Jello and cottage cheese?

The hardest part of defining abs is finding them. In order to see your abs, you must lose the body fat. After your fat is gone, you still have to build up muscle tissue, and that requires protein.

A low fat, high protein diet doesn't need to be boring, though.

Here are a few fun, easy recipes to help you get started.

Tofu is very high in protein and is great for building lean muscle. It is very common in Asian cuisine and is becoming popular in Western cooking because it can be a versatile, low-fat replacement for meat or dairy in many dishes. It can be found in the produce section of most grocery stores.

Tofu Strawberry Banana Shake

INGREDIENTS:
1 block silken or soft tofu
1 frozen banana
1 cup crushed pineapple (with juice)
1/2 cup skim milk or soy milk
4 strawberries

PREPARATION:
1. Drain the tofu and cut it into chunks.
2. Chop the banana and remove the strawberry stems.
3. Mix all ingredients in blender or food processor.

Time to Prepare: 5 minutes
Makes 1 serving

Tip: Add protein powder for an extra boost.

Lentils

Lentils (both red and brown) are also a protein powerhouse. The following recipe looks so complicated, you'll impress your dinner date. But don't let the long ingredients list fool you - it's so simple that you can make it even if you have no cooking experience. Add the spices to your taste to make it mild or spicy.

Indian Curried Red Lentil Soup
(Taken from Vegetarian Times, March 2004)

1 cup red lentils (rinsed)
4 1/2 cups nonfat vegetable stock
2 Tbs. nonfat plain yogurt
1 tsp. curry powder
1 tsp. grated fresh ginger (or powdered)
1/2 tsp. ground cumin
1/2 tsp. cayenne
1/2 tsp. onion powder

Possible garnishes may be:
* Shredded coconut
* Dried peanuts
* Cilantro
* Diced red pepper
* Chutney
* Raisins

1. Put lentils and vegetable stock in a large
saucepan, and bring to a boil over medium-high
heat.
2. Reduce heat to medium, and
cook for about 20 minutes, or until lentils
are tender.
3. Reduce heat to very low.
4. Put 2 cups lentils and yogurt into
blender, and puree until smooth.
5. Recombine with soup in pan, and stir in seasonings.
6. Heat and serve, garnishing each portion as desired.

Time to Prepare: 30 minutes
Makes 6 servings

There are many places on the Web where you can find free, simple recipes to lower your fat and build your muscle.

If you're bored of the same old thing, try Japanese cooking - it is typically low in fat and high in vitamins and protein. Also, even if you're not a vegetarian, check out some vegetarian recipes. Vegetarian cuisine has virtually no fat and a lot of health benefits.

Remember, abs diet recipes don't have to be dull and bland. Get creative with your cooking. Your abs and your taste buds will both thank you.
